微信如何链接网页(微信链接网页方法)


微信作为国民级社交平台,其链接网页的能力直接影响着信息传播效率和商业转化路径。从技术实现到运营策略,微信链接网页涉及多维度的机制设计,既包含基础的技术接口调用,又涉及复杂的平台规则约束。当前主流的链接方式涵盖直接URL跳转、小程序路径、二维码识别、H5页面嵌套等类型,每种方式在兼容性、审核机制、数据追踪和场景适配性上存在显著差异。例如,公众号图文中的外部链接需依赖域名白名单机制,而小程序则通过自有体系实现闭环跳转。值得注意的是,微信对网页内容的安全检测已形成自动化过滤体系,敏感词库和图片识别算法持续迭代,导致部分正常链接可能被误判拦截。此外,不同终端(iOS/Android)的浏览器内核差异、微信版本更新带来的API变动、以及平台政策对诱导分享的严格限制,均构成链接稳定性的潜在风险。
一、技术原理与接口调用
微信链接网页的核心依赖于JS-SDK接口体系,开发者需通过wx.config()
完成初始化配置。关键参数包括debug
(调试模式)、appId
(公众号唯一标识)、timestamp
(时间戳)、nonceStr
(随机串)及signature
(签名算法)。其中签名生成需对JSAPI票据(jsapi_ticket)做SHA1加密并拼接请求参数,确保接口调用合法性。
接口类型 | 功能描述 | 权限要求 |
---|---|---|
wx.miniProgram.navigateTo | 跳转至指定小程序页面 | 需关联同主体小程序 |
wx.openLocation | 调起地理位置界面 | 需用户授权位置信息 |
wx.downloadImage | <下载图片至本地相册 | 需用户授权存储权限 |
二、域名白名单机制
微信对网页链接实施严格的域名管控策略,未备案域名或未加入白名单的HTTP/HTTPS链接将被拦截。企业主体需通过微信公众号后台配置业务域名、JS接口安全域名、网页授权域名三类核心参数。
域名类型 | 配置场景 | 审核周期 |
---|---|---|
业务域名 | 用于自定义菜单跳转、模板消息推送 | 即时生效 |
JS安全域名 | 调用JS-SDK接口的合法域 | 24小时 |
网页授权域 | OAuth2.0授权回调地址 | 7个工作日 |
三、内容安全检测体系
微信采用多层级内容过滤机制,包含文本关键词匹配、图片MD5比对、音频特征识别三重校验。系统通过异步队列处理用户访问请求,对疑似违规内容触发人工复审流程。
检测维度 | 拦截阈值 | 处理方式 |
---|---|---|
政治敏感词库 | 100%匹配即拦截 | 直接阻断访问 |
广告诱导词汇 | 权重累计≥5分 | 限制传播范围 |
二维码叠加信息 | <识别层数≥3层 | 冻结二维码效力 |
四、链接类型与场景适配
根据业务需求可选择不同链接形态:
- 普通URL链接适用于快速导流
- 小程序路径支持参数传递和版本控制
- 活码二维码可动态更新跳转地址
- H5短链便于跨平台传播
五、跨平台兼容性处理
设备类型 | 浏览器内核 | 异常处理方案 |
---|---|---|
iOS微信内置浏览器 | WebKit引擎 | 禁用WKWebView私有API |
Android微信浏览器 | X5内核/系统内核 | 强制启用硬件加速 |
PC端微信 | Chromium内核 | 规避Flash依赖 |
六、数据追踪与效果归因
微信提供UTM参数标注体系,支持utm_source
(来源)、utm_medium
(媒介)、utm_campaign
(活动)等6类标准参数。开发者可通过云函数捕获queryString
实现精准归因,但需注意参数长度不超过2048字符。
七、审核规范与风险规避
违规类型 | 典型特征 | 整改建议 |
---|---|---|
诱导分享 | 奖励式转发提示 | 改用服务通知触达 |
虚假信息 | 夸大宣传用语 | 增加免责声明 |
隐私泄露 | 未匿名化数据收集 | 实施GDPR合规改造 |
八、性能优化与体验提升
首屏加载时间需控制在3秒内,建议采用以下策略:
- 开启CDN加速并配置HTTP/2
- 对DOM元素进行懒加载处理
- 压缩资源文件至15KB以下
- 预加载核心CSS样式表
wx.stopRecordShareTime
接口可关闭分享轨迹统计,降低性能损耗。微信链接网页的机制设计体现了平台对生态安全与用户体验的双重考量。从技术接口的严谨调用到内容审核的智能过滤,从域名管理的精细控制到数据追踪的完整闭环,企业需在合规框架下探索最优解决方案。未来随着小程序容器技术的深化和WebAssembly的应用,网页链接形态或将向轻量化、智能化方向演进,但核心始终围绕用户价值与平台规则的平衡展开。





